PASSMORES headteacher, Vic Goddard has appeared on the BBC to discuss the use of social media by pupils.

Mr Goddard was a guest on BBC2’s Newsnight where the main item was a discussion on the pressures on children between the age of eight and twelve and the use of social media such as Facebook, Snapchat and Instagram.

The first question was “If you had a chance to eradicate social media for all those under-16, would you take it?

Vic Goddard said: “Yes, the ability to communicate orally is massively affected by their use of social media. It affects their life chances”

Another speaker felt it has been massively overplayed and has been a force for good.

Vic added: “It is about control. We have got to translate what is going on in the real world. Would you allow a stranger to talk to their child in the park? No. But a stranger has the chance to be in your child’s bedroom through social media.

“We let phones in, it is in the bag. A phone is a privilege, not a right. This is not tough love, this is care.

“A parent that gives their child a phone without boundaries is reneging on their responsibilities.
